the dissidenten were an offspring of embryo one of the early jazzy krautrock bands founded 1969 in munich (two years after amon düül). embryo had already been travellng a lot, they were probably the first world music band, the dissidenten which were called embryo's dissidenten in the beginning tried to appeal to a wider public and merged arab and indian music with dance pop. they were great but in the end they didn't have the success they should have had.
